Question
Attached you can see a block diagram of our power design. Is the ADuM3070 /
4070 able to deliever enough power for this design in the 5V -> 5V
configuration? Total power on the galvanic isolated loads should be
180mW+66mW+900mW = 1.146W. But it is plenty of power dissipation on the LDO’s.
What do you think?
Answer
Assuming 80% efficiency for the dc to dc for the +/-20V means about 250mA
current from the ADuM3070 5V, plus the 80mA, 25mA and 20mA from the other LDOs
gives a total of 375mA at 5V output. This meets the 400mA specified for the
ADuM3070. You just need to use the specified or better components in the
ADuM3070 application circuit, especially the schottky diodes.
You should check on the efficiency of the dc to dc that provides the +/-20V
since if this were low, say 70%, would draw a total 410mA, 10mA over specified.
